STEINBECK, John.

East of Eden.

FIRST BRITISH EDITION, FIRST PRINTING. London, Melbourne, and Toronto: William Heinemann Ltd, 1952.

8vo, 525 pp. Original green cloth lettered in gilt to spine, in the publisher's pictorial dust jacket with bold black serif typography on a yellow ground, priced 15s net on the front flap and unclipped. Front-flap blurbs from Orville Prescott (The New York Times) and Lewis Gannett (New York Herald Tribune). The Heinemann edition was separately set, running 525 pp against the Viking New York first's 602 pp (Goldstone & Payne A32).

The novel runs across two generations of two Salinas Valley families — the Trasks and the Hamiltons — built on a Cain-and-Abel allegorical structure.
